Understanding Web3 Wallets

Web3 wallets can either be software applications or hardware devices used to manage public and private keys crucial for blockchain interactions. These keys serve as credentials, certifying ownership and authorizing transactions, thereby allowing users to bu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. While all Web3 wallets fall under the umbrella of crypto wallets, not all crypto wallets can be classified as Web3 wallets.

The defining characteristic of Web3 wallets is their ability to engage with decentralized finance (DeFi), which aims to minimize reliance on traditional financial intermediaries. A key component of this ecosystem is decentralized applications (dApps), which can solely be accessed through Web3 wallets.

Functionality of Web3 Wallets

It’s important to note that a Web3 wallet does not store cryptocurrency itself; instead, the digital coins and tokens exist on the blockchain, while the wallet serves as a means to access them. Primarily, Web3 wallets manage keys and function as a digital identity in the decentralized web. For instance, when visiting a dApp, users can connect their wallet without the need for traditional usernames and passwords. The wallet digitally signs messages, confirming ownership of the address, thereby allowing interactions with funds,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s), and other digital assets.

To start using a Web3 wallet, users generally download the application or browser extension, create a new wallet, secure their recovery phrase, and deposit a small amount of cryptocurrency for transactions. This setup allows users to send or receive tokens, connect to dApps, swap assets, stake crypto, and monitor NFTs all within the wallet’s interface.

Key Features to Consider When Choosing a Web3 Wallet

When selecting a Web3 wallet, potential users should consider several important factors:

  1. Security: This is paramount in any crypto wallet. A secure wallet will utilize strong recovery methods, possess robust security features such as transaction controls and anti-phishing protections, and undergo third-party audits to assess vulnerabilities.

  2. Blockchain and Token Support: Not all wallets are compatible across every blockchain. It is crucial to verify that the chosen wallet supports the tokens and networks the user plans to engage with.

  3. Usability: For beginners in the crypto space, ease of use is vital. A wallet with a straightforward setup and user-friendly interface can lessen the complexity often associated with Web3 wallets. Many wallets also offer educational resources to assist new users in navigating their features.
